Describe a time you worked with a difficult team member and how you handled it.

11 years ago

Can you describe a time you had to work with a difficult team member and how you handled the situation?

This is a common behavioral interview question designed to assess your interpersonal skills, conflict resolution abilities, and ability to work effectively in a team environment, even when faced with challenges. When answering this question, it's crucial to provide a specific example, detailing the situation, your actions, and the resulting outcome. This allows the interviewer to understand your approach and evaluate your effectiveness.

For instance, you might discuss a project where a team member consistently missed deadlines, hindering the team's progress. In your response, you should:

  1. Describe the Situation: Clearly outline the project, the team member's role, and the specific behaviors that made them difficult to work with (e.g., missed deadlines, lack of communication, negative attitude). Be objective and avoid accusatory language.
  2. Explain Your Actions: Detail the steps you took to address the situation. Did you have a one-on-one conversation with the team member? Did you involve a supervisor or mentor? Did you try to understand the reasons behind their behavior? Did you adjust your own approach to accommodate their needs?
  3. Highlight the Result: Explain the outcome of your actions. Were you able to resolve the issue? Did the team member improve their performance? What did you learn from the experience? Even if the outcome wasn't ideal, focus on the lessons learned and how you would approach a similar situation in the future.

Remember, the STAR method (Situation, Task, Action, Result) can be a helpful framework for structuring your answer. The interviewer wants to see that you can navigate challenging interpersonal dynamics professionally and contribute to a positive team environment.

Sample Answer

Introduction

I'd like to share an experience from my time at Google, where I was part of a team developing a new feature for Google Maps. During this project, I encountered a situation where a team member's work style and communication significantly impacted the team's progress. This situation taught me valuable lessons about conflict resolution, empathy, and the importance of clear communication in a team environment.

Situation

As a software engineer at Google, I was assigned to a project focused on enhancing the user experience of Google Maps by integrating real-time traffic updates. Our team consisted of five engineers, each responsible for different modules of the feature. One of the engineers, let's call him Alex, was consistently behind schedule and often unresponsive to team communications.

  • Alex was responsible for integrating the data from our traffic sensor API.
  • Deadlines were frequently missed, which cascaded and impacted the work of other team members.
  • Alex rarely responded to emails or messages, making it difficult to understand the roadblocks.

Task

My primary task was to ensure the successful integration of the real-time traffic updates into the Google Maps application. To achieve this, I needed to:

  • Identify the underlying reasons for Alex's performance and communication issues.
  • Collaborate with Alex to find solutions that would help him meet deadlines and improve communication.
  • Minimize the impact of the delays on the overall project timeline.

Action

I decided to take a proactive approach to address the situation. Here are the steps I took:

  • One-on-One Conversation: I scheduled a private meeting with Alex to discuss the challenges he was facing. I made sure to approach the conversation with empathy and without judgment. I started by acknowledging his expertise and contributions to the team.
  • Active Listening: During the conversation, I actively listened to Alex to understand the reasons behind his delays and lack of communication. I learned that he was struggling with the complexity of the API and felt overwhelmed by the project's scale.
  • Offer Support: I offered my assistance to help Alex overcome the technical challenges. I also suggested breaking down the tasks into smaller, more manageable chunks.
  • Collaborative Problem-Solving: Together, we identified specific areas where he needed support. I spent time pair programming with him, explaining the intricacies of the API and helping him debug his code.
  • Communication Plan: We established a clear communication plan to ensure regular updates on his progress. This included daily check-ins and weekly progress reports.
  • Escalation (If Necessary): I made it clear that if we couldn't resolve the issues together, I would need to involve our team lead to ensure the project's success.

Result

After our conversation and the subsequent support, there was a noticeable improvement in Alex's performance and communication.

  • Alex started meeting deadlines consistently.
  • Communication improved significantly, with regular updates and prompt responses to team inquiries.
  • The project was completed successfully and launched on time.
  • The team's morale improved as the stress caused by the delays was alleviated.

Conclusion

This experience taught me the importance of proactive communication, empathy, and collaborative problem-solving in a team environment. By addressing the situation head-on and offering support, I was able to help a struggling team member improve their performance and contribute to the success of the project. This situation also reinforced the value of open communication and the importance of creating a supportive and understanding team culture. I learned that addressing interpersonal issues promptly and professionally can significantly improve team dynamics and project outcomes, as well as helping me grow as a software engineer.